Creative expression can be an important way for children and youth to build confidence, process emotions, and experience joy. At Sunshine Residential Homes, we support opportunities for children to explore creativity through activities such as painting, music, drama, creative writing, crafts, and other forms of artistic expression.
Our goal is to create safe and encouraging spaces where children and youth can try new things, express themselves, and participate in positive experiences outside of their daily routines. These activities may take place through community events, seasonal programs, guest instructors, local opportunities, and staff-supported projects within our homes.
We recognize that many children entering care have experienced trauma, disruption, or loss. While creative activities are not a replacement for professional behavioral health services, they can provide meaningful opportunities for self-expression, connection, and normalcy. Whether a child is discovering a new interest, building a skill, or simply enjoying a fun activity with peers, these experiences can support emotional well-being and a sense of belonging.

Preparing for adulthood is an important part of supporting teens and young adults in care. At Sunshine Residential Homes, we help youth build practical skills that may support greater independence, future employment, and confidence in everyday life.
Our vocational and skill development support may include age-appropriate guidance with job readiness, resume building, interview preparation, workplace expectations, personal responsibility, time management, communication skills, and goal setting. Youth may also receive support exploring college, vocational programs, career interests, and employment opportunities consistent with their service plan, case plan, and individual needs.
We understand that many youth in care have experienced disruption in school, family life, and community connections. Because of this, skill development is not only about preparing for a job; it is about helping youth build confidence, consistency, and the ability to navigate real-world responsibilities. Staff encourage youth to practice daily living skills such as budgeting, hygiene, household routines, nutrition, transportation planning, and appropriate decision-making.
Sunshine also supports youth in staying connected to education and future planning. Through school coordination, tutoring connections, academic encouragement, and recognition of progress, we help youth remain focused on the steps that can lead to graduation, employment, vocational training, or greater independence.
Our goal is to provide structure, encouragement, and real-world learning opportunities while each youth’s larger team works toward the most appropriate next step. Whether a youth is preparing for reunification, kinship care, foster placement, another permanency plan, or independent living, Sunshine is committed to helping them develop skills that support stability, responsibility, and hope for the future.
